Brethren– Just prior to composing this message I received an e-mail from a friend with an attachment that included an article from the Los Angeles Times dated May 18, 2008, “Freemasonry in the midst of popularity, membership boom”. I found it quite interesting; in fact it reminded me a bit of Warren #13 with sort of a California twist. It describes how Freemasonry is “booming” in Southern Ca.- “KAbooming” in our case with men in their 20s sharing camaraderie and fellowship with men in their 80s. Some wearing full dress tuxedos while others in more casual dress maybe showing a tattoo or some piercing, some financially set and others still struggling a bit, but all on an even keel in the Craft. It goes on to say that we numbered over 4 million in the 50s, but membership plummeted to just 1.5 million today, however the trend seems to be reversing itself and we are making a comeback. They credit this to the internet, as most Lodges now have websites and has made it easier to learn about Freemasonry since we don’t actively solicit membership. It also gives prospective members information about our Fraternity that previously wasn’t available until one would actually join. The advantage of this is that new candidates already have some knowledge as to what Freemasonry is and are thus more likely to be active members and to stay active. They know that as Masons they can make a positive difference and that the rewards of being a Brother can be priceless. Brethren this is good news.
